实时建站全流程:高效开发技术揭秘
|
在服务网格工程师的视角下,实时建站的核心在于如何将基础设施与应用逻辑无缝集成,确保系统的高可用性、可扩展性和快速迭代能力。现代开发流程中,从需求分析到部署上线,每一步都需要精准的技术支撑。
2025效果图由AI设计,仅供参考 实时建站的关键在于采用微服务架构,通过服务网格技术实现服务间的高效通信与管理。借助Istio、Linkerd等工具,可以轻松实现流量控制、服务发现和安全策略,为后续的自动化部署打下坚实基础。 在代码层面,开发者应优先选择轻量级框架,如Go、Node.js或Python,以提升执行效率并减少资源消耗。同时,结合CI/CD流水线,实现代码提交后自动构建、测试和部署,大幅缩短交付周期。 数据层的设计同样不可忽视,实时建站需要高效的数据库方案,例如使用Redis作为缓存层,结合PostgreSQL或MongoDB进行持久化存储。合理的索引设计和读写分离策略能够显著提升系统性能。 监控与日志是保障系统稳定运行的重要环节。通过Prometheus、Grafana和ELK栈,可以实时追踪服务状态、分析性能瓶颈,并在问题发生前进行预警。服务网格本身也提供了丰富的观测数据,便于深入分析。 安全性始终是建站过程中不可妥协的底线。从TLS加密到访问控制,再到漏洞扫描和合规检查,每一项措施都需严格遵循最佳实践,确保系统在高速迭代的同时保持高度可信。 (编辑:站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|

